2013 Film Lineup for the Ecofocus Film Festival in Athens, Ga.
The Ecofocus Film Festival is from March 20 to 24th.
The mission of EcoFocus is to inform and inspire audiences about environmental issues through film. Our primary activity is the annual film festival, which features engaging and often award-winning films from around the world presented with dynamic speakers, panel discussions and events. Films selected for EcoFocus reveal the planet’s beauty and the environmental challenges facing this and future generations, and highlight inspirational stories about people working to protect the environment and its inhabitants.

Feature Films

- Bidder 70 directed by Beth Gage and George Gage
- Cafeteria Man directed by Richard Chisolm and Sheila Kinkade
- Cape Spin! An American Power Struggle directed by John Kirby, Robbie Gemmel, Daniel Coffin, and Libby Handros
- Chasing Ice directed by Jeff Orlowski
- Dear Governor Cuomo directed by Jon Bowermaster
- Last Call at the Oasis directed by Jessica Yu
- Switch directed by Harry Lynch
- The Human Scale directed by Andreas Møl Dalsgaard
- The Lost Bird Project directed by Deborah Dickson
- The Tsunami and the Cherry Blossom directed by Lucy Walker
- Trash Dance directed by Andrew Garrison
Short Films
- Among Giants directed by Ben Mullinkosson, Sam Price-Waldman, and Chris Cresci
- Bag It (2013 EcoKids Presentation) directed by Suzan Beraza
- Cafeteria Man: Memphis Schools Makeover directed by Richard Chisolm and Sheila Kinkade
- Gaia Soil directed by Directed by Philip Buccellato and Jesse Ash
- Irish Folk Furniture directed by Tony Donoghue
- Living Tiny directed by Paul Donatelli and Paul Meyers
- Quagga directed by Olga and Tatiana Poliektova
- Ripple Effect Film Project Finalist Showcase directed by Various
- The Artificial Leaf directed by Jared P. Scott
- The Last Ice Merchant directed by Sandy Patch
- The Man Who Lived on His Bike directed by Guillaume Blanchet
EcoKids
- Bag It (2013 EcoKids Presentation) directed by Suzan Beraza
